Vice principal demographics research summary. Zippia estimates vice principal demographics and statistics in the United States by using a database of 30 million profiles. Our vice principal estimates are verified against BLS, Census, and current job openings data for accuracy. Zippia's data science team found the following key facts about vice principals after extensive research and analysis:

  • There are over 34,298 vice principals currently employed in the United States.
  • 49.7% of all vice principals are women, while 50.3% are men.
  • The average vice principal age is 47 years old.
  • The most common ethnicity of vice principals is White (65.5%), followed by Hispanic or Latino (14.5%), Black or African American (10.9%) and Asian (4.4%).
  • In 2022, women earned 94% of what men earned.
  • 16% of all vice principals are LGBT.
  • Vice principals are 88% more likely to work at education companies in comparison to private companies.

Vice principal wage gap by degree level

According to the data, vice principals with a Doctorate degree earn more than those without, at $108,766 annually. With a Master's degree, vice principals earn a median annual income of $99,486 compared to $87,610 for vice principals with an Bachelor's degree.

Where do vice principals earn the most?

Vice principals earn the most in New Jersey, where the average vice principal salary is $101,215. The map here shows where vice principals earn the highest salaries in the U.S. The darker areas across the 50 states highlight the highest salaries.
